在编程和数据分析领域中,“evaluate”(评估)是一个常见且重要的概念。Evaluate函数通常用于动态地执行一段代码或表达式,并返回其结果。简单来说,它可以帮助我们根据输入的表达式或字符串形式的代码来得出计算结果。
例如,在Python中,`eval()`函数就是一个典型的evaluate实现。它可以接收一个字符串作为参数,并尝试将其解析为有效的Python表达式并执行。这种功能在需要灵活处理用户输入或者构建动态脚本时非常有用。
然而,使用evaluate函数也需要注意安全性问题。由于它能够执行任意代码,如果未经妥善处理,可能会导致安全漏洞,比如代码注入攻击。因此,在实际应用中,应该对传入的内容进行严格的验证和过滤,确保只有预期的数据才能被处理。
此外,不同的编程语言可能有不同的方式来实现类似的evaluate功能。了解这些差异有助于开发者选择最适合特定场景的方法。总之,evaluate函数的核心在于它的灵活性和强大性,但同时也要求使用者具备足够的谨慎态度。
希望这篇文章符合您的需求!如果有其他问题或需要进一步帮助,请随时告知。